Falcon series of Bushnell binoculars are known for their superb power and build quality for an affordable price. The 133410 model fits this category perfectly well – it disposes of InstaFocus lever that offers an accurate picture and a Porro prism with coated lenses for the sharpness of the image. Besides, it has got foldable eyecups that are especially useful for those of you who wear eyeglasses on a daily basis. Fold them down and thus eliminate the distance between your eyes and binoculars for a bright and steady picture.
Although a 35 mm objective lens might seem insufficient, the real-time buyers prove that it fully meets their outdoor and sports-watching requirements. Bring it with you on your next outing that calls for binoculars in a case that comes with it and enjoy the view in comfort.

Specs & Features
- Magnification: 7x
- Objective Diameter: 35 mm
- Field of View @1000 yds: 420 ft.
- Dimensions: 8 x 6.2 x 3 in
- Weight: 21 oz.
